Browse Source

alloca is NOT machine dependent; it has exactly the same

effective result.  its use is NOT discouraged -- it is not
common, but when you need it, there is nothing else that will do.
OPENBSD_5_2
deraadt 12 years ago
parent
commit
d00b320411
1 changed files with 3 additions and 7 deletions
  1. +3
    -7
      src/lib/libc/stdlib/alloca.3

+ 3
- 7
src/lib/libc/stdlib/alloca.3 View File

@ -25,9 +25,9 @@
.\" OUT OF THE USE OF THIS SOFTWARE, EVEN IF ADVISED OF THE POSSIBILITY OF .\" OUT OF THE USE OF THIS SOFTWARE, EVEN IF ADVISED OF THE POSSIBILITY OF
.\" SUCH DAMAGE. .\" SUCH DAMAGE.
.\" .\"
.\" $OpenBSD: alloca.3,v 1.11 2007/05/31 19:19:31 jmc Exp $
.\" $OpenBSD: alloca.3,v 1.12 2012/04/12 15:46:57 deraadt Exp $
.\" .\"
.Dd $Mdocdate: May 31 2007 $
.Dd $Mdocdate: April 12 2012 $
.Dt ALLOCA 3 .Dt ALLOCA 3
.Os .Os
.Sh NAME .Sh NAME
@ -54,10 +54,6 @@ function returns a pointer to the beginning of the allocated space.
.Xr calloc 3 , .Xr calloc 3 ,
.Xr malloc 3 , .Xr malloc 3 ,
.Xr realloc 3 .Xr realloc 3
.Sh BUGS
The
.Fn alloca
function is machine dependent; its use is discouraged.
.\" .Sh HISTORY .\" .Sh HISTORY
.\" The .\" The
.\" .Fn alloca .\" .Fn alloca
@ -66,7 +62,7 @@ function is machine dependent; its use is discouraged.
.\" The function appeared in 32v, pwb and pwb.2 and in 3bsd 4bsd .\" The function appeared in 32v, pwb and pwb.2 and in 3bsd 4bsd
.\" The first man page (or link to a man page that I can find at the .\" The first man page (or link to a man page that I can find at the
.\" moment is 4.3... .\" moment is 4.3...
.Pp
.Sh BUGS
The The
.Fn alloca .Fn alloca
function is slightly unsafe because it cannot ensure that the pointer function is slightly unsafe because it cannot ensure that the pointer


Loading…
Cancel
Save